Design intent and character
Monospaced clarity
The core Nobula Hubiont family maintains uniform character widths, which enhances readability in code editors, tabular layouts, and UI components. Each glyph aligns predictably on a grid, which improves scanning speed in technical documents and developer tools. The consistent rhythm of the typeface reduces visual noise and allows designers to build clean, efficient typographic systems.
Pixel-inspired alternates
The alternate font introduces edgy, pixelated details that recall vintage 8-bit and Y2K styling. These alternates emphasize square forms, stepped terminals, and compact counters to create a distinct retro-futuristic voice. Use the alternates to evoke gaming nostalgia, evoke cyberpunk interfaces, or to add character to headlines and logos without sacrificing the core monospaced structure.

How to use and access alternates
Enable OpenType features in your design application to access alternates and ligatures. In software such as Adobe Illustrator, InDesign, or Figma (with OpenType support), toggle stylistic sets or alternates to switch between the standard monospaced glyphs and the pixelated variants. For quick testing, install both the primary and alternate font files and compare side-by-side to select the treatment that best fits your project tone.
Installation and web use
Desktop installation
Install the provided .OTF or .TTF file using your operating system’s font manager. Restart active design applications to ensure the new font appears in font menus.
Web usage
Convert the font to web formats (WOFF/WOFF2) for reliable browser delivery and serve via @font-face. Confirm and apply appropriate web licensing before embedding the typeface on public websites or within web applications.
Pairing and styling tips
Pair Nobula Hubiont with neutral sans-serifs for balanced layouts, or with condensed display faces for bold, technical compositions. Use the pixel alternates sparingly for headings and UI elements to preserve legibility in body text. Adjust letter-spacing modestly when combining alternates with photographic or high-contrast backgrounds.
